Department Summary

The Business Information Technology (BIT) team is dedicated to designing, developing, configuring, enhancing, optimizing, and maintaining innovative products and platforms that enable UCLA's core business functions, including Web Technologies, Budget & Financial Management, Human Resources Information, Customer Relationship Management, and Collaboration, Productivity, & Workplace Products. In partnership with administrative stakeholders, BIT ensures that its solutions deliver exceptional functionality, quality, business value, user experience, and digital accessibility, meeting the diverse needs and expectations of the campus community. The BIT team drives ITS' cloud-first strategy by reducing technical debt, leveraging cutting-edge techniques, partnering with other departments and teams to accelerate releases through advanced automation and application lifecycle management, and fostering a culture of continuous improvement and innovation to ensure scalable, flexible solutions that meet UCLA's evolving demands. The Budget & Financial Management Products team conceives, configures, monitors, defines, tests, delivers, optimizes, and refines budget & financial management products and application technologies, including but not limited to the Financial System (FS) General Ledger Applications, financial ERP, and procure to pay products. This team also focuses on optimizing user experience, addressing digital accessibility needs, partnering with cross-functional delivery teams to ensure products meet business and user requirements, and collaborating with business stakeholders to iteratively improve the products over time.
Position Summary

The Software Developer, Procure to Pay IT Products will develop and configure back-end services product solutions, adhering to coding best practices and standards. They will maintain the legacy mainframe purchasing systems. They will help ensure that all functionality and capabilities meet the needs of a broad range of customers, partners, and key stakeholders by translating requirements into code that enhances the usability, creates business value, and elevates the customer experience. This team member will also conduct testing, troubleshooting, and debugging to enable optimal performance. Additional responsibilities include conducting research of emerging technologies and industry practices; making recommendations regarding best practices and technologies for adoption and providing input to continual improvement activities for assigned projects.
